That doesn’t help as it’s based on flawed data. The Harvard/YouGov data was based on unscientific non-probability polling. That in itself is a major handicap. Even worse, there are inconsistencies which cannot be overcome where they polled the same respondents every 2 years and were given different answers to the same question. That question was, are you a citizen; and there were numerous instances where respondents answered ‘yes’ in one year, but then ‘no’ when polled 2 years later.
Another serious flaw was the small sample of respondents who identified themselves as being an illegal alien. The smaller the sample, the less reliable the polling. Just Facts’ exasperated that flaw by extrapolating the results to the full number of illegal aliens in the country, which only explodes the margin of error. Even worse for Just Facts’, they ignored the actual “official” number of illegal aliens in the country and made up their own number; greatly increasing the size of those they claim voted illegally.
